GPR33 Polyclonal Antibody, 100ul Primary Antibodies The encoded protein is aThis gene has been identified as an orphan chemoattractant G protein coupled receptors (GPCR) pseudogene. Studies have shown that the inactivated gene is present as the predominant allele in the human population. A small fraction of the human population has been found to harbor an intact allele.
